We arrived early for our ferry to Yarmouth and so decided to have something from the cafe while we waited - it’s in the ferry terminal building and has a good range of food, drink and snack options at reasonable prices. We opted for the afternoon tea deal - hot drink and slice of cake for £4.20. It can get busy if people are waiting for the ferry but there’s plenty of seating, especially outside (fine if the weather’s conducive). Friendly staff and prompt service. Curlew cafe would probably not be your natural destination of choice unless taking the ferry but it’s definitely worth popping in whilst waiting - there’s also clean toilet facilities.
